North of Nome (Arrow Film, 1925). Folded, Very Fine-. Six Sheet (80.5" X 81").A story of love and betrayal set in the Yukon in the Alaskan wilds, this silent action film stars Gladys Johnstone with Robert N. Bradbury and Robert McKim, who is most remembered for his role as Douglas Fairbanks' rival in The Mark of Zorro. One of his only two performances in front of the camera, Bradbury is far more well known as a director of a multitude of early Westerns starring his son, Bob Steele, and also ones featuring a young John Wayne. This six sheet (which is likely the only surviving example of this poster) is an excellent example of the beautiful images typical of posters of the silent era, with its detailed rendering of the lead characters, their dog sled and dogs, and watercolor-like background with colors reminiscent of a glowing aurora borealis. In absolutely wonderful condition for its age, this poster comes with all four of its panels and shows pinholes in the black background, small edge tears and nicks, fold wear with mild splits and crossfold separations, a tear in the upper background, and a thin scratch in the image area. There are small stains in the middle of the upper background and in the "E" in Robert McKim's credit.
